Sean Carroll, a physicist known for clear, rigorous explanations, guides readers through the foundational questions at the heart of quantum theory: what is reality made of, how do particles know what to do, and why does the cosmos behave the way it does at the smallest scales? The book digs into the Many-Worlds interpretation, presenting a compelling case for taking alternative outcomes seriously as an integral part of the quantum picture, rather than as a provocative afterthought. Carroll also tackles the tension between quantum mechanics and Einstein’s general relativity, offering a reasoned path toward reconciling these pillars of physics. The journey blends historical context, conceptual clarity, and bold ideas about how a quantum substratum could give rise to spacetime itself.
